    Published: June 7, 2025 | Author: Mark Campbell At Summer Game Fest, Mundfish has unveiled Atomic Heart II, a new retrofuturistic RPG from Mundfish. With this new game, Mundfish aims to expand the game to a “global scale” and “raise the bar for what an open-world action RPG can do”. Based on the trailer, the game appears crazy in scope. We have vehicles racing across beaches, Cyberpunk-like nightclubs, combat with wall-running, telekinetic and more.

    Published: June 7, 2025 | Author: Mark Campbell At Summer Games Fest, Techland has unveiled the release date of Dying Light: The Beast alongside a “Gameplay Premiere” trailer for the game. It’s coming to PC, Xbox Series X/S, and PlayStation 5, with the PC version landing on Steam and the Epic Games Store. In The Beast, players will control Kyle Crane, the protagonist of the original Dying Light. Having survived years of experimentation, Kyle has a mix of human and zombie DNA.

    Published: June 6, 2025 | Author: Mark Campbell Console releases are rare, and day-1 system purchasers are no doubt excited to get their hands on the latest and greatest gaming hardware. Sadly, some Switch 2 purchasers have received damaged systems, as GameStop employees have stapled receipts to their Switch 2 boxes, punchering their handheld’s screen. Thankfully, this incident was limited to a single GameStop location in New York. Below, we can see a user with an affected Switch 2 console.
